A mixing model for bottomoniumlike resonances

arXiv:1707.00565 · doi:10.1103/PhysRevD.96.094024

Abstract

The isovector bottomoniumlike exotic resonances and are very close to the thresholds of heavy meson pairs and , and are naturally understood as `molecular' states made of the corresponding meson-antimeson pairs. The picture with a full separation of the two channels cannot be exact and a cross-feed between the states necessarily takes place. A simple model is considered here describing the mixing between the channels in terms of one parameter. The model reasonably describes the current data on the decays of the resonances to bottomonium plus a pion and predicts the rate and a distinctive interference pattern for the decay as well as excess of the mass splitting between the resonances over the mass difference between and mesons.
